Complementary Teaching of Physics and Arts

Dragana Milićević, Ljubiša Nešić, Angelos Angelopoulos, Takis Fildisis

Open publisher page 0 citations

Abstract

Requirements of modern education, interest and understanding of students, the application of knowledge in various fields of physics and changed teacher‐student relations impose the need for better understanding of scientific notions and their connections. The aim of research presented in this paper is to establish the effects of complementary or integral teaching of physics and arts and connections of the corresponding topics from these two subjects.
